Trump Victory held its fourth National Day of Action (NDOA) of 2020 on Saturday. An incredible total of 1.4 million total voter contacts were made during the day.

This National Day of Action was 100 percent virutal. It was the first time 100 percent of calls came from the comfort of folks in their own homes using the Trump Talk app.

The calls encouraged voters to visit the CDC website, follow their guidance and stay safe in addition to highlighting what President Donald Trump and his administration are doing to fight the Coronavirus.

Throughout last week, there were hundreds of Trump Victory Leadership Initiative trainings held in virtual settings. These meetings help train volunteers on in-home call applications and ways to engage with voters virtually.

The TVLI trainings are designed to spur rapid volunteer growth and spread the message of Trump’s campaign and the Republican Party to every town in the country.

Saturday’s NDOA increased the total number of voter contacts to nearly nine million, which is far ahead of where efforts were in 2016 and 2018. In fact, the number of calls made Saturday alone was higher than any total week’s calls in 2018 until mid-September.

Between the RNC and the Trump campaign, more than 550,000 volunteers have been trained and activated. Supporters can visit TrumpVictory.com to become involved.

In Iowa, there have been nearly 240,000 voter contacts and more than 300 trainings. Last week, during the week of action, Iowans made more than 50,000 voter contacts.

These efforts extend down the ballot as well. Within 24 hours of President Trump’s social distancing announcement, the RNC had digitized its entire field program.

“The RNC’s ability to digitize its entire field operation within 24 hours is a testament to the strength of its permanent ground game,” said RNC spokesperson Preya Samsundar. “While we continue to outmatch the Democrats in resources and fundraising, our ability to organize our army of volunteers no matter the situation will propel us to victory.”
